A 10 kg remote control plane is flying at a height of 111 m. How much
potential energy does it have?
Answer:
10.88kJ
Explanation:
Given data
mass= 10kg
heigth= 111m
Applying
PE= mgh
assume g= 9.81m/s^2
substitute
PE= 10*9.81*111
PE=10889.1 Joules
PE=10.881kJ
Hence the potential energy is 10.88kJ
You perform nine (identical) measurements of the acceleration of gravity (units of m/s2): 10.1, 9.87, 9.76, 9.91, 9.75, 9.88, 9.69, 9.83, and 9.90. The true value is 9.81. Calculate the mean value of your results to three significant digits. ________
Answer: The mean value = 9.85m/s².
Explanation:
Mean = [tex]\dfrac{\text{Sum of n observations}}{n}[/tex]
The given measurements the acceleration of gravity (units of m/s²): 10.1, 9.87, 9.76, 9.91, 9.75, 9.88, 9.69, 9.83, and 9.90.
Number of measurements =9
Sum of measurements = 88.69
Mean = [tex]\dfrac{88.69}{9}=9.85444444\approx9.85[/tex]
Hence, the mean value = 9.85m/s².
